Biography
Part-time since 2023— Before my current appointment, I held postdoctoral research roles at Oxford, Cambridge, Imperial College London, and MIT, where I was awarded the Fulbright Fellowship (at MIT and the University of North Carolina), I am also a recipient of the Prince of Wales Innovation Scholarship. My publications include over 100 peer-reviewed articles and several books.
